VoIP - MGCP
Configure the parameters accordingly. Click
OK
to confirm the modification or
click
Cancel
to discard the modification.
Table 32
VoIP - MGCP Field Description
Item Description
Local Port This port number to receive/send data from/to the call agent.
Default: 2427
Call Agent Address The IP address of call agent.
Default: 127.0.0.1
Call Agent Port This port number to receive/send data from/to the VoIP gateway.
Default: 2727
Wild-carded RSIP Enable / disable wild carded RSIP
Default: disable
Endpoint Name Style Style: aaln/#@[ip_addr], mac_addr/#@[ip_addr],
aaln/#@mac_addr, aaln/#@domain_name.
Default: aaln/#@[ip_addr]
Gateway Domain The domain name of the gateway
Default: domain.net
Expires The period that the VoIP gateway sends keeping-alive message to
the call agent. This is check the connection status in case the VoIP
gateway is accidentally disconnected from the call agent.
Default: 150 seconds.
